  2. WEKO AUTOMATION + TOOLS GMBH

    Germany

    The company WEKO Entgratungstechnik GmbH was founded in 1975 in Altenbuch. The early products were trimming tools in various sizes designed for the foundry industry. In 1996, the production site was expanded when the company moved to new premises in Faulbach. This was accompanied by the expansion of the production portfolio with the introduction of hydraulic trimming presses. By combining robot technology with our reinforced presses, we are now able to provide fully automated casting systems. Since 2009, WEKO Automation + Tools GmbH has been continuing to expand its product range. The company is structured into the following divisions: –Construction, –Electrical and software development, –Mechanical engineering/plant construction– Tool construction. This enables us to meet the high standards set by the automotive industry.
